can somebody tell me the maximum boost i can crank the stock turbo.
 
Depends on how much fuel you throw at it. remember, that more boost does not always equal more power. What mods do you have?
 
If you want it to live long you won't want to take it past 25psi regularly.


Which means I'll be needing a aftermarket one sooner or later ... LOL
 
i got a superchips programmer, AEM cold air intake, 5 in. mbrp turbo back banks wastegate and wheel compressor. Im looking for trade the superchips for ts performance 6 position chip. AM i on the good way.
 
They will live quite long at 25-27# boost, after that they start telling you they dont like it...
 
Agree with the above posts, my turbo gave up when I started pushing it to 30+. I played with the Map sensor line making it lose vaccuum by inserting a piece of brake line in it with a small hole drilled in it. She gave up after a couple of thousand miles pushing 30+

The Garrett BB 38R solved the problem as a replacement and has been giving me good service for the past 60,000 miles hitting 35+ lbs. regularly.
